How much do collab j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 4, 2026, the average hourly pay for collab in the United States is $25.72,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.31 and $34.13 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Collaboration Spec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Collaboration Specialist, you need a strong background in project management, cross-functional teamwork, and organizational communication, often supported by a relevant degree or experience in business or communications. Familiarity with collaboration platforms such as Microsoft Teams, Slack, SharePoint, and project management tools like Asana or Trello is typically required. Outstanding interpersonal skills, adaptability, and conflict resolution abilities set exceptional candidates apart in this role. These skills ensure effective team coordination, streamlined workflows, and productive outcomes in dynamic workplace environments.

How does a Collaboration Specialist typically facilitate effective teamwork across different departments?

A Collaboration Specialist plays a key role in bridging communication and workflow gaps between departments by organizing regular cross-functional meetings, implementing collaborative tools, and fostering a culture of open feedback. They often coordinate with project managers, team leads, and IT to ensure everyone is aligned on goals and timelines. Navigating differing priorities and communication styles can be a challenge, but strong organizational and interpersonal skills help Collaboration Specialists create a cohesive team environment. This role also involves monitoring project progress and resolving conflicts to keep initiatives on track.

What are 'Collab' jobs?

'Collab' jobs typically refer to roles focused on collaboration, either within a team or between different organizations. These positions emphasize teamwork, communication, and the ability to work effectively with others to achieve shared goals. The term 'Collab' is often used in creative industries, such as content creation, where individuals or brands work together on joint projects. In the workplace, Collab roles may involve project management, partnership development, or facilitating cross-functional initiatives. The primary skill set for these jobs includes interpersonal communication, adaptability, and a collaborative mindset.

Collab: Tech Specialist
This is an opportunity to be part of something bigger, to help people connect, learn, and embrace the future with confidence. If you're ready to engage, educate, and inspire, we invite you to join us in shaping the next generation of digital experiences.
Town & Country Federal Credit Union is looking for a friendly, engaging individual who loves working with people and is curious about new technology. As a Collab: Tech Specialist, you'll help members and guests explore our interactive Collab: Tech space, where technology and community come together.
This isn't a technical support or IT role, it's about making technology approachable, showing people how to use it, and helping them feel confident with tools like our mobile banking app, voice AI, and other digital solutions. We'll train you on the technology, we just ask that you bring enthusiasm, people skills, and willingness to learn.
At Town & Country, we believe progress happens when people connect, share ideas, and learn together. Collab: Tech is our way of creating a welcoming, hands-on space where guests can learn about and experience new technology in action.
Function and Responsibilities
As a Collab: Tech Specialist, your goal is to make technology approachable and engaging while fostering an environment where people feel encouraged to explore new ideas.
  • Welcome visitors and create a friendly, engaging experience in the Collab: Tech space.
  • Show members how to use our digital banking tools and other emerging technologies.
  • Demonstrate new products and services so visitors leave feeling confident and informed.
  • Act as a connector, introducing people to opportunities within the credit union and the community.
  • Support Collab events by assisting with technology demonstrations and engaging with attendees.
  • Stay curious and up to date on new tools so you can share them in simple, relatable ways.

Interpersonal Skills
This role requires an engaging communicator who enjoys helping people feel comfortable with technology. The ideal candidate is adaptable, curious, and energized by personal interactions.
  • A people person, you enjoy meeting new people and making them feel comfortable.
  • A natural teacher, you can explain new ideas in clear, simple terms.
  • Adaptable, you enjoy learning and aren't afraid to try something new.
  • Energetic and positive, you bring enthusiasm to every interaction.
  • Experienced in customer service, retail, hospitality, or a related field.
